The Nanaimo Regional Hospital District (NRHD) has confirmed its five major areas of focus for capital planning and advocacy are the patient tower replacement, new cancer centre, cardiac catheterization lab and a new high acuity unit, all to be located at Nanaimo Regional General Hospital (NRGH), as well as a long-term care facility in the region.
“Unless we have these facilities on site, we are not going to be able to treat heart attacks,” said Dr. Arun Natarajan, a cardiologist at NRGH. “It’s very unusual that we don’t have this facility here.”
